blob: ce705dcf53210b02c02e0729025ef9563af6c763 [file] [log] [blame]
Elyes HAOUAS36787b02020-05-07 12:07:24 +02001# SPDX-License-Identifier: GPL-2.0-only
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+01002
Angel Pons95de2312020-02-17 13:08:53 +01003config NORTHBRIDGE_INTEL_IRONLAKE
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+01004 bool
5 select CPU_INTEL_MODEL_2065X
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+01006 select VGA
Vladimir Serbinenko13157302014-02-19 22:18:08 +01007 select INTEL_EDID
Vladimir Serbinenkodd2bc3f2014-10-31 09:16:31 +01008 select INTEL_GMA_ACPI
Arthur Heymansdc71e252018-01-29 10:14:48 +01009 select CACHE_MRC_SETTINGS
Arthur Heymansb3282092019-04-14 17:53:28 +020010 select HAVE_DEBUG_RAM_SETUP
Elyes Haouas04610052022-12-31 08:17:47 +010011 select USE_DDR3
Julius Wernerc770ad62024-06-03 17:39:01 -070012 select NEED_SMALL_2MB_PAGE_TABLES
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010013
Angel Pons95de2312020-02-17 13:08:53 +010014if NORTHBRIDGE_INTEL_IRONLAKE
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010015
Patrick Rudolph2a93d282019-09-18 12:07:19 +020016config VBOOT
17 select VBOOT_MUST_REQUEST_DISPLAY
Arthur Heymans2ea4efe2019-10-10 15:57:22 +020018 select VBOOT_STARTS_IN_BOOTBLOCK
Arthur Heymansf240a322019-10-15 11:25:14 +020019 # CPU is reset without platform/TPM during romstage
20 select TPM_STARTUP_IGNORE_POSTINIT
Patrick Rudolph2a93d282019-09-18 12:07:19 +020021
Martin Roth59ff3402016-02-09 09:06:46 -070022config CBFS_SIZE
Martin Roth59ff3402016-02-09 09:06:46 -070023 default 0x100000
24
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010025config VGA_BIOS_ID
26 string
27 default "8086,0046"
28
29config DCACHE_RAM_BASE
30 hex
Kyösti Mälkkic86c6b32016-12-09 17:43:27 +020031 default 0xfefc0000
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010032
33config DCACHE_RAM_SIZE
34 hex
35 default 0x10000
36
Arthur Heymans28822532019-10-10 15:50:04 +020037config DCACHE_BSP_STACK_SIZE
38 hex
39 default 0x2000
40 help
41 The amount of anticipated stack usage in CAR by bootblock and
42 other stages.
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010043
Shelley Chen4e9bb332021-10-20 15:43:45 -070044config ECAM_MMCONF_BASE_ADDRESS
Arthur Heymansca24fe42019-09-16 12:46:12 +020045 default 0xe0000000
46
Shelley Chen4e9bb332021-10-20 15:43:45 -070047config ECAM_MMCONF_BUS_NUMBER
Angel Ponsb274ec72021-01-20 14:03:44 +010048 default 256
49
Nico Huber612a8672019-02-19 19:11:29 +010050config INTEL_GMA_BCLV_OFFSET
51 default 0x48254
52
Angel Ponsa8df6cf2021-01-20 01:32:17 +010053config FIXED_MCHBAR_MMIO_BASE
54 default 0xfed10000
55
56config FIXED_DMIBAR_MMIO_BASE
57 default 0xfed18000
58
59config FIXED_EPBAR_MMIO_BASE
60 default 0xfed19000
61
Vladimir Serbinenkoc6f6be02013-11-12 22:32:08 +010062endif